## 3.2.0 — Key rotation

The Gridsmith plugin signing key used since 2.x is retired, effective this release. Plugins signed with the old key will load with a warning until 3.4.0, then fail outright. Action required: re-sign your plugin bundles and resubmit to the Clueforge registry. No API changes in this release; grid solver and clue ranker are unchanged. The new public verification key is below.

deploy key for kajof-fajop: bky6_gDHw9Q

# DocSweep Linter — Environment Variables

DocSweep lints our internal documentation tree nightly and files issues for broken anchors and stale screenshots. If the nightly run fails, check the worker logs first; most failures are rate limiting against the wiki API. Relevant variables: DOCSWEEP_ROOT points at the docs repo checkout, DOCSWEEP_CONCURRENCY defaults to 4, and DOCSWEEP_DRY_RUN suppresses issue creation. All of these live in /etc/docsweep/.env on the worker. The wiki API credential goes on the line immediately after those entries.

sealed setting: ARCHIVE_KEY3=8d0

Subject: Fire drill Thursday — roll call duties

Team assistants,

Drill at 10:15 Thursday, Marlow Point. You each take your team's roll-call sheet from reception by 09:30. Muster at the Calder Street forecourt; report headcounts to the chief warden, not to me. Missing names get flagged immediately — no waiting. Drill ends when wardens signal; re-entry through the west doors only. The sheets cabinet behind the front desk opens with the code below.

— Front Desk

staff pass of kawip-hawef = bdg-QLP-2